👀 SPOILER-FREE SUMMARY

A tonal shift that catches you off guard — in a good way. Episode 21 pulls back from the usual comedic energy and ecchi antics to deliver something unexpectedly personal. The focus narrows to familial bonds, estrangement, and the messy work of reconnection, with Okumura serving as a catalyst in bringing a father and daughter back together. The pacing is deliberately slower, letting emotional beats land with real weight instead of rushing to the next gag. Character development takes center stage here, and the writing earns its quieter moments. If you've been watching primarily for the laughs and fan service, this episode asks for patience — but it rewards it with genuine emotional depth that adds new dimensions to the cast. A standout entry that proves the series has range beyond its genre trappings.

📍 ARC CONTEXT

Coming off the high-energy collaborative spectacle of Summer Comiket in the previous episodes, episode 21 pivots sharply into intimate character territory, using the post-event cooldown to explore personal histories that the series has kept on the margins. Positioned at episode 21 of 24, this is the show investing in emotional stakes before the final stretch. The next episode, 'This Wonderful World,' signals a return to lighter Okumura-Ririsa dynamics, making this introspective detour a deliberate contrast that deepens the landing zone for the season's conclusion.
